Public urged to 'recycle their tech' as rare, valuable materials in millions of old devices languish in UK homes.

Gallium: Used in medical thermometers, LEDs, solar panels, telescopes and has possible anti-cancer properties;Silver: Used in mirrors, reactive lenses that darken in sunlight, antibacterial clothing and gloves for use with touch-screens;

Many people who hoard old tech are concerned about protecting their personal data, but a"factory reset" should protect that - and council tips and responsible retailers keep electronics secure before they recycled. Much of the responsibility for that will lie with tech manufacturers, according to Prof Lenny Koh, director of the Centre for Energy, Environment and Sustainability at the University of Sheffield.
